Jul 31, 2020 For an M20 grade of concrete, the ratio is (1:1.5:3) ie, (1 part of cement: 1.5 part of sand: 3 part of Aggregate) Let us assume for 1 Cum. Of M20 concrete, So, Wet volume of concrete = 1 Cum. Dry volume of concrete = 1.54 times of the wet volume of concrete (Here 1.54 stands. as “Factor of safety” to counter the shrinkage) = 1.54 Cum

Aug 03, 2018 Consider volume of concrete = 1m3. Dry Volume of Concrete = 1 x 1.54 = 1.54 m3 (For Dry Volume Multiply By 1.54) Now we start calculation to find Cement, Sand and Aggregate quality in 1 cubic meter concrete. CALCULATION FOR CEMENT QUANTITY; Cement= (1/5.5) x 1.54 = 0.28 m 3 ∴ 1 is a part of cement, 5.5 is sum of ratio

Table 2 Maximum Water Content per cubic meter – IS10262. For aggregate = 20mm, Slump = 50mm. Maximum Water Content. = 186 L. But we need a 75mm slump in our concrete as per the specification given in section 1. Clause 4.2 suggests an increase of 3% of water content in increase slump by 25mm slump in concrete

Oct 14, 2021 For 1 cum of Cement Concrete of M20 grade (1:1.5:3), the total sand required will be 0.425 Cum. The rate of sand per cum is 1500 thus total amount will be 1500 x 0.425 = ₹ 637.50. For a 5Km distance, the rate for carrying one cum sand is 163.93 thus total cost will be 0.425 x 163.93 = ₹ 69.67

For 1 Cubic Metre of M20 (1:1.5:3) Broken stone = 0.856 Cubic Metre. Sand = 0.472 Cubic Metre. Cement = 8.22 bags. Some important conclusion from above. 8 bags of Cement is required for 1 cu.m. of concrete work in M20. 4.4 bags of cement is required for 1 cu.m. of concrete work in M10(1:3:6). volume of dry concrete =1.54 times volume of wet concrete
